When something bad happens…
“Will I become happy if I can regard the bad things that happen to me as not being bad?“
Just as there are no good days or bad days, there are no such things as good things or bad things.
Rather than trying hard not to think of something as bad, you need to realize that there is nothing that is inherently bad in this world.
